Output d80a98dc3c3dc7f0ef5064c448766054f44522c5d4b9056ea307fa436bd24e3f:1

value
15614384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65bfe810ff262946b780ddeeb0395170bbde6ddf OP_EQUAL
address
3Ay24pKUnTLPjq8V1BUuB1g6QCTPbYJLWh
transaction
d80a98dc3c3dc7f0ef5064c448766054f44522c5d4b9056ea307fa436bd24e3f
spent
true